問題タブ [search]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
10 に答える
1048 参照

sql - SQL テキスト検索、および順序付け

クエリがあります:

結果を並べ替えるにはどうすればよいですか?

「foo」に一致する行と「bar」に一致する行があるが、「foobar」を含む行もあるとしましょう。

最初の結果がより多くの LIKE に一致するものになるように、返された行を並べ替えるにはどうすればよいですか?

0 投票する
1 に答える
3177 参照

sharepoint - SharePoint Services 3.0 Wiki での検索結果表示のカスタマイズ

Windows SharePoint Services 3.0 wiki をメタデータ リポジトリとして使用することを検討しています。私たちは基本的にコミュニティ主導の辞書を望んでおり、さまざまな理由から MediaWiki の代わりに Sharepoint を使用しています。

searchresults.aspx をカスタマイズまたは完全に置き換えるにはどうすればよいですか?

方法を知っていれば追加する機能:

  1. 検索語に 100% 一致する場合、1 位のヒットを自動的に読み込みます
  2. 各結果の最初の数行をプレビューとして表示し、ユーザーがクリックして悪い結果に移動する必要がないようにする
  3. 100% 一致しない場合は、「ページが存在しません。ここをクリックして作成してください」リンクを追加します。

SharePoint Designer をインストールしました。これを使用して、作成したカスタム .aspx ファイルをアップロードできるようですが、searchresults.aspx にアクセスできるようには見えません。

注: URL パラメーターを介して外部サイトからこの検索ツールにアクセスする予定なので、既存の searchresults.aspx を変更せずに、このソリューションを補完的な検索オプションとしてロードするだけで問題ありません。

0 投票する
5 に答える
1376 参照

search - 軽量検索インデックス API/ライブラリ

オープン ソースの検索インデックス ライブラリを探しています。組み込み Web アプリケーションに使用されるため、コード サイズは小さくする必要があります。できれば、C、C++、または PHP で記述されており、インデックスを格納するためにデータベースをインストールする必要はありません。代わりに、インデックスはファイルに保存する必要があります (例: xml、txt)。xapian や clucene などの有名な検索ライブラリを調べてみました。これらは優れていますが、組み込みシステムとしてはコード サイズが比較的大きくなります。

これは Linux プラットフォームで実行され、HTML ファイルのインデックス作成に使用されます。

使用するのに適した検索ライブラリ/API について何か考えはありますか?

ありがとう。

0 投票する
4 に答える
4280 参照

sharepoint - より多くの列で SharePoint 検索結果を並べ替える

SharePoint 2007 (MOSS) で FullTextSqlQuery を使用しており、結果を 2 列で並べ替える必要があります。

ただし、結果を返すときに ORDER BY の最初の列のみが考慮されるようです。この場合、結果はランク順ではなく、作成者順で正しく並べられます。順序を変更すると、結果は作成者ではなくランク順になります。

結果を自分でソートする必要がありましたが、これはあまり好きではありません。これに対する解決策はありますか?

編集: 残念ながら、ORDER BY 句の式も受け入れません (SharePoint は例外をスローします)。私の推測では、クエリが正当な SQL のように見えても、SQL サーバーに提供される前に何らかの方法で解析されます。

SQL プロファイラーでクエリをキャッチしようとしましたが、役に立ちませんでした。

編集 2 : 最後に、単一の列 (私の場合は最も重要なので作成者) による順序付けを使用し、結果の TOP N でコードで 2 番目の順序付けを行いました。プロジェクトとしては十分に機能しますが、コードがぎこちなく感じられます。

0 投票する
14 に答える
119008 参照

search - Vim で検索したもののハイライトを解除するにはどうすればよいですか?

ファイルで「nurple」を検索します。見つけました、すごい。しかし今では、「nurple」のすべての出現は、黄色の上にシックな黒でレンダリングされます. 永遠に。

永遠に、つまり、「asdhfalsdflajdflakjdf」など、見つからないことがわかっているものを検索するまで、以前の検索の強調表示をクリアするだけです。

検索が終わったら、魔法のキーを押してハイライトを消すことはできませんか?

0 投票する
6 に答える
16735 参照

sharepoint - MOSS 2007 クロール

私が持っている 2 つの別々のファームでクロールを機能させようとしていますが、どちらでも機能させることができません。どちらも 2 つの WFE を持ち、追加の WFE がインデックス サーバーとして構成されています。クエリ専用のサーバーがもう 1 台と、データベース用にクラスター化された SQL 2005 バックエンド サーバーが 2 台あります。検索エンジンのソリューションで見つけた少なくとも 50 の異なる Web サイトを試してみましたが、うまくいきませんでした。http://servername:12345をデフォルト ゾーンとして使用し、http: //abc.companyname.comをカスタム ゾーンおよびイントラネット ゾーンとして使用するように Web アプリを構成 (拡張)しました。それぞれをコンテンツ ソースに入力してクロールを実行しようとすると、クロール ログにいくつかのエラーが記録されます。

http://servername:12345
は 、「サーバーに接続できませんでした。サイトにアクセスできることを確認してください。」を返します。

http://abc.companyname.comの戻り値:
「Gatherer によって削除されました。(このアイテムを含む開始アドレスまたはコンテンツ ソースが削除されたため、このアイテムも削除されました。)」

ただし、両方の URL をクリックでき、ページにアクセスできます。

何か案は?


より詳しい情報:

いわばスレートを一掃し、別のクロールを実行して更新されたサンプルを提供しました。

私のコンテンツソースは次のとおりです。

http://servername:33333
http://sharepoint.portal.fake.com
sps3://servername:33333

現在のクロール ログ エラーは次のとおりです。

sps3://servername:33333
PortalCrawl Web サービスでエラーが発生しました。

http://servername:33333/mysites
この URL のコンテンツは、インデックス属性がないため、サーバーによって除外されます。

http://servername:33333/mysites
クロール

sts3://servername:33333/contentdbid={62a647a...
クロール済み

sts3://servername:33333
クロール済み

http://servername:33333
クロール済み

http://sharepoint.portal.fake.com
クローラーがサーバーと通信できませんでした。サーバーが使用可能であること、およびファイアウォール アクセスが正しく構成されていることを確認してください。

上記のタイプミスを再確認しましたが、何も表示されないため、これは正確な反映であるはずです.

0 投票する
21 に答える
15574 参照

r - 「R」素材の検索方法は?

「The Google」は非常に役に立ちます...あなたの言語が「R」と呼ばれている場合を除きます。

「R」の検索エンジンのトリックを知っている人はいますか? 以下のような専門的な Web サイトがいくつかありますが、「R」という言語を意味していると Google に伝えるにはどうすればよいでしょうか。特定のものを検索する場合は、「cbind」などの R 固有の用語を使用します。他にそのようなトリックはありますか?

0 投票する
21 に答える
22600 参照

regex - 複数のファイルの正規表現を見つけて置き換えるのに最適なツールは何ですか?

できれば無料のツールが望ましい。

また、複数の正規表現を検索し、それぞれを異なる文字列に置き換えるオプションはおまけです。

0 投票する
2 に答える
4015 参照

vb.net - Google 検索 API を使用した単純な VB.NET?

VB.net (2008) で実装できる Google API (AJAX Search API だと思いますか?) の良い、単純な例を誰か教えてもらえますか? Google API キーにサインアップしようとしましたが、検索を実行する URL が必要です。この例の URL はありません。http://localhostを試してみましたが、同僚から「無効なキー」エラーが発生したと言われました。簡単な実例は素晴らしいでしょう。ありがとうございました。

0 投票する
9 に答える
12217 参照

search - ウェブ検索エンジンの構築

私は以前から Web 検索エンジンの開発に興味がありました。始めるのに適した場所は何ですか? Lucene のことは聞いたことがありますが、私は Java にあまり詳しくありません。他に良いリソースやオープンソース プロジェクトはありますか?

それが大事業であることは理解していますが、それは魅力の一部です。私は次の Google を作成するつもりはありません。関心のあるサイトのサブセットを検索するために使用できるものにすぎません。